기술의 발전은 우리의 일상과 산업 전반에 구조적인 변화를 가져오며, 때로는 ‘번개치기’와 같은 갑작스러운 혁신을 통해 전통적인 방식을 완전히 뒤바꿀 수 있습니다. 이러한 기술적 번개치기는 산업을 변화시키는 데 중요한 역할을 하며, 그 과정에서 새로운 기회와 도전을 동반합니다.
1. 인공지능(AI)과 머신러닝의 등장
인공지능과 머신러닝은 최근 몇 년간 기술적 번개치기를 이끌고 있습니다. AI는 데이터 분석, 예측 모델링, 자율 주행차 등 다양한 분야에서 혁신적인 변화를 가져왔습니다. 예를 들어, 자율 주행차는 교통 산업에 큰 변화를 가져다주며, 교통 취약계층에게 새로운 기회를 제공하고 있습니다.
# 예시: 자율 주행차의 기본 알고리즘
class AutonomousCar:
def __init__(self):
self.sensors = ["camera", "radar", "ultrasound"]
def drive(self):
for sensor in self.sensors:
data = self.collect_data(sensor)
self.process_data(data)
def collect_data(self, sensor):
# 센서 데이터 수집 로직
pass
def process_data(self, data):
# 데이터 처리 로직
pass
2. 블록체인 기술의 확산
블록체인 기술은 투명성과 보안을 강화하며, 다양한 산업에서 구조적인 변화를 가져오고 있습니다. 특히, 금융 산업에서는 블록체인 기술을 통해 거래의 신뢰성을 높이고, 거래 비용을 절감하고 있습니다.
# 예시: 블록체인 기술을 활용한 가상 화폐 거래
class Blockchain:
def __init__(self):
self.chain = []
self.create_block(0, 'initial_block')
def create_block(self, index, previous_hash):
new_block = {
'index': index,
'timestamp': time.time(),
'data': 'transaction_data',
'previous_hash': previous_hash
}
self.chain.append(new_block)
def get_last_block(self):
return self.chain[-1]
blockchain = Blockchain()
blockchain.create_block(1, blockchain.get_last_block()['previous_hash'])
3. 클라우드 컴퓨팅의 발전
클라우드 컴퓨팅은 데이터 저장과 처리의 효율성을 높이며, 기업의 운영 비용을 절감하고 있습니다. 클라우드 기반 솔루션은 원격 작업, 데이터 분석, 최적화된 리소스 관리 등 다양한 혜택을 제공합니다.
# 예시: 클라우드 컴퓨팅을 활용한 데이터 분석
import pandas as pd
import numpy as np
# 데이터 로드
data = pd.read_csv('data.csv')
# 데이터 분석
result = data.describe()
# 결과 출력
print(result)
4. 5G 네트워크의 도입
5G 네트워크는 빠른 데이터 전송 속도와 낮은 지연 시간을 제공하며, 기술적 번개치기를 촉진하고 있습니다. 5G는 자율 주행차, 실시간 데이터 분석, 멀티플레이어 게임 등 다양한 분야에서 혁신적인 변화를 가져올 것입니다.
# 예시: 5G 네트워크를 활용한 실시간 데이터 전송
import requests
import time
while True:
data = {
'sensor_data': 'temperature',
'value': 25
}
response = requests.post('http://5g-server.com/data', json=data)
time.sleep(1)
결론
기술적 번개치기는 산업을 변화시키는 중요한 요인으로, 새로운 기술의 등장과 발전이 기업과 사회에 큰 영향을 미칩니다. 이러한 변화를 이해하고 활용하면, 더 나은 미래를 만들어갈 수 있습니다.
